CDOT BEGINS ANOTHER AMERICAN RECOVERY & REINVESTMENT ACT (ARRA) FUNDED PROJECT IN SAN LUIS VALLEY

Resurfacing on US 160 west of Del Norte
 
RIO GRANDE COUNTY - The Colorado Department of Transportation has begun a project to resurface a 3.3-mile stretch of US 160 west of Del Norte. The work is being paid for through the American Recovery & Reinvestment Act and involves a pavement overlay (one inch of leveling course and two inches of new asphalt) between mile posts 197.7 (east of CR 17) and 201 (west of 1st Street).

 

"Thanks to funds from the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act we can finally make significant improvements to US 160 west of Del Norte," Congressman John Salazar (CO-03) said. "I thank the hard work of the participants of the San Luis Valley Regional Planning Commission for recommending and prioritizing this stretch of US 160 for funding. These improvements will help our farmers and ranchers get to market, our communities to safely travel to and from work, and will welcome visitors traveling to the beautiful San Luis Valley."


The project has received ARRA funding in the amount of $2.1 million and was contracted to Elam Construction.


TRAVEL IMPACTS:  Throughout the duration of the project on US 160 (scheduled for completion by October 30), motorists will encounter single-lane, alternating traffic from 7 AM to 7 PM, Monday through Friday (there will be no work this Friday, October 9, a state government furlough day).
